Unpacking the New Features
The introduction of Forms is a game changer for Canva users. This feature streamlines the process of gathering information, making it easier for businesses to conduct surveys, collect feedback, or manage event registrations. With customizable templates and intuitive drag-and-drop functionality, setting up a form that aligns with brand aesthetics is both quick and visually appealing.
Additionally, Canva’s new email design tools position the platform as a serious contender against traditional email marketing services. Users can create stunning, professional-grade emails without any coding knowledge. This is particularly beneficial for small business owners and content creators who want to enhance their outreach while maintaining consistent visual branding.
Affinity Goes Free: A Strategic Shift
In an unrelated but noteworthy move, the design application Affinity has now become free for all users. This shift hints at a broader industry trend where software developers seek to democratize access to high-quality design tools. With Affinity’s robust features now available at no cost, users can explore advanced design capabilities without the usual financial barriers. This might shift user preferences, particularly among graphic designers and digital marketers who rely heavily on design software.
